What are the components of a car?

4 Answers
KhloeMarie
08/29/25 8:46am
Car consists of powertrain, chassis, body, and electrical components. Powertrain: The main function is to transmit the engine's power to the drive wheels, mainly composed of transmission, drive shaft, differential, etc. In front-engine rear-wheel drive configurations, there is also a propeller shaft. Chassis: The chassis serves to support and install the car engine and its various components and assemblies, forming the overall shape of the car. It receives the engine's power to generate motion and ensure normal driving. Body: The body is mounted on the frame of the chassis to accommodate the driver, passengers, or cargo. Electrical components: The electrical components consist of power sources, electrical devices, and the software part of the electronic control unit. This part is prone to damage and requires attention during daily use.

As an experienced driver, I understand that a car's structure mainly consists of several major components. The body frame acts like the car's shell, protecting passengers from impacts, including doors, windows, and the roof structure. The powertrain is the core, where the engine burns fuel to generate power, along with cooling systems like radiators to prevent overheating. The drivetrain transfers power from the engine to the wheels, involving components such as the transmission and drive shafts. The chassis supports the entire vehicle, including the suspension system and wheels, ensuring smoother rides and shock absorption. The steering system controls direction via the steering wheel. The braking system ensures safe stopping, composed of the brake pedal, calipers, and discs. The electrical system is also essential, with the battery powering all devices and headlights illuminating the road at night. The dashboard provides real-time data like speed and fuel consumption. I'm in the auto repair business and deal with car structures daily. The body frame is the foundation, while under the hood lies the engine core that burns gasoline to power everything. The drivetrain is responsible for transferring power, including the clutch or automatic transmission. Chassis components are crucial—the suspension system absorbs road vibrations, with wheels and shock absorbers working in tandem. The braking system can't be overlooked; the hydraulic master cylinder pushes calipers to squeeze discs for deceleration. On the electrical side, the battery powers the starter motor, lights, sensors, and the Engine Control Unit (ECU), which manages engine parameters. The cooling system circulates fluid to prevent engine overheating. Common issues like worn brake pads causing noise or unstable stops remind us to regularly check brake fluid and shock absorbers. As a professional, I recommend changing engine oil every 5,000 km to protect the timing chain and reduce wear. Understanding these structures makes fault diagnosis easier—for example, checking fuses when headlights fail to avoid sudden breakdowns. What is the horsepower of the Golf R?

The Golf R has a horsepower of 290. The Golf R uses Volkswagen's third-generation EA888 engine, which has a maximum torque of 380 Nm and can deliver maximum power between 5,400 and 6,500 rpm, and maximum torque between 1,850 and 5,300 rpm. This engine is equipped with direct fuel injection technology and uses an aluminum alloy cylinder head and an iron cylinder block. The 2.0-liter turbocharged engine is paired with a 7-speed dual-clutch transmission, which offers fast gear shifts and high transmission efficiency. The front suspension of the Golf R uses a MacPherson independent suspension, while the rear suspension uses a multi-link independent suspension. It also features an all-wheel-drive system and a multi-plate clutch-type center differential.

What is the Principle of Panoramic Reversing Camera?

The principle of panoramic reversing camera is as follows: Four cameras record all videos around the vehicle body, which are then connected to the control host (core) via connecting cables. The control host processes the images captured by the cameras—stitching and correcting them—to restore the real images around the vehicle body. Below is a related introduction to panoramic reversing cameras: 1. Function: Panoramic bird's-eye parking assistance is more intuitive. Whether it's front-first parking, rear-first parking, or side parking, it ensures accurate positioning, improves parking efficiency, and effectively prevents scratches during parking. 2. Composition: The panoramic reversing camera system consists of two core components: cameras and an image processor.

Does the BYD F3 have airbags?

BYD F3 is equipped with airbags, but only the driver and front passenger seats have airbags. In the event of a collision, the airbags can evenly distribute the impact force across the head and chest, preventing direct contact between the passenger's body and the car body, significantly reducing the likelihood of injury. The BYD F3 is a compact sedan powered by a 1.5L naturally aspirated engine, with a maximum power output of 80 kW and a maximum power speed of 5,800 rpm. The dimensions of the BYD F3 are 4,533 mm in length, 1,705 mm in width, and 1,490 mm in height, with a wheelbase of 2,600 mm. It is equipped with a 5-speed manual transmission and uses tires with specifications of 195/60R15.

What Causes Sudden Loss of Airflow in Car AC?

Sudden loss of airflow in car AC is mainly caused by three common issues: blower motor failure, AC filter malfunction, and control system failure. Below is relevant information about car AC systems: 1. AC Types: Based on control methods, they are divided into: manual (adjusting temperature, fan speed, and air direction via function keys on the control panel) and electro-pneumatic control (using vacuum control mechanisms to automatically regulate temperature and airflow within preset ranges when function keys are selected). 2. AC Components: Modern AC systems consist of refrigeration systems, heating systems, ventilation and air purification devices, and control systems.
